2026/4/18 10:23:17
网站建设
项目流程
网站开发的背景知识,餐饮品牌设计方案,东莞企业推广网站制作,长沙房价2021新楼盘价格Hekate引导程序安全更新与工具升级技术指南 【免费下载链接】hekate hekate - A GUI based Nintendo Switch Bootloader 项目地址: https://gitcode.com/gh_mirrors/he/hekate
本文将详细介绍Hekate引导程序的安全更新方法和版本升级教程#xff0c;通过系统化的操作流…Hekate引导程序安全更新与工具升级技术指南【免费下载链接】hekatehekate - A GUI based Nintendo Switch Bootloader项目地址: https://gitcode.com/gh_mirrors/he/hekate本文将详细介绍Hekate引导程序的安全更新方法和版本升级教程通过系统化的操作流程确保设备在升级过程中的安全性与稳定性。我们将从环境准备、版本兼容性检查、文件验证到配置迁移等关键环节提供全面的技术指导帮助用户安全完成工具升级。一、环境准备与兼容性检查在执行Hekate引导程序升级前需完成环境评估与兼容性验证这是确保升级过程顺利的基础步骤。1.1 当前版本确认启动设备并进入Hekate界面版本信息通常显示于屏幕底部状态栏。记录当前版本号以便后续确认升级是否成功。1.2 系统兼容性检查Hekate不同版本对硬件和系统环境有特定要求需执行以下检查# 检查设备硬件型号 cat /sys/firmware/devicetree/base/model # 查看当前系统版本 nvflash --getversion1.3 数据备份策略风险提示升级过程存在数据丢失风险建议执行完整备份将SD卡连接至计算机复制整个bootloader目录至本地存储重点备份以下配置文件bootloader/hekate_ipl.inibootloader/nyx.inibootloader/patches.inibootloader/res/目录下的自定义资源二、升级文件获取与验证获取官方发布的升级文件并进行完整性验证是保障升级安全的关键步骤。2.1 官方文件获取通过以下命令克隆官方仓库获取最新版本git clone https://gitcode.com/gh_mirrors/he/hekate cd hekate git checkout $(git describe --abbrev0 --tags)2.2 文件完整性校验使用SHA256哈希值验证文件完整性# 生成文件哈希值 sha256sum hekate_ctcaer_*.zip # 对比官方提供的校验值 # 官方校验值通常位于发布页面的checksums.txt文件中风险提示若哈希值不匹配可能文件已被篡改请勿使用该文件进行升级。三、升级操作流程遵循以下步骤执行升级操作确保文件替换的准确性和完整性。3.1 旧文件清理在替换新文件前需清理旧版本文件以避免冲突# 删除过时系统文件 rm -rf /mnt/sdcard/bootloader/sys rm /mnt/sdcard/bootloader/nyx.bin # 备份当前配置额外保险措施 cp -r /mnt/sdcard/bootloader /mnt/sdcard/bootloader_backup3.2 新版本文件部署将下载的升级包解压并部署到SD卡# 解压升级包 unzip hekate_ctcaer_*.zip -d /tmp/hekate_update # 复制新文件到SD卡 cp -r /tmp/hekate_update/bootloader /mnt/sdcard/3.3 配置文件迁移从备份中恢复个性化配置# 恢复核心配置文件 cp /mnt/sdcard/bootloader_backup/hekate_ipl.ini /mnt/sdcard/bootloader/ cp /mnt/sdcard/bootloader_backup/nyx.ini /mnt/sdcard/bootloader/ # 恢复自定义资源 cp -r /mnt/sdcard/bootloader_backup/res/* /mnt/sdcard/bootloader/res/四、升级验证与功能测试完成文件替换后需进行系统性验证以确保升级成功。4.1 版本验证启动设备并进入Hekate界面确认版本号已更新为目标版本。可通过以下命令进一步验证# 查看hekate版本信息 hekate --version4.2 核心功能测试执行以下测试以确认系统功能正常验证所有引导项是否正确显示测试触摸屏和物理按键响应检查虚拟系统(emuMMC)启动功能确认外部存储设备识别正常4.3 配置有效性检查检查配置文件是否正确应用[config] autoboot1 bootwait5 backlight180 autonogc0 debugmode1 [CFW] kip1modules/loader.kip kip2modules/sm.kip secmonmodules/secmon.img五、升级后系统优化完成升级并验证功能后可进行系统优化以提升性能和安全性。5.1 启动参数优化根据硬件配置调整启动参数# 在hekate_ipl.ini中添加或修改以下参数 [config] overclock1785 emummc_force_disable05.2 系统清理移除升级过程中产生的临时文件# 清理临时文件 rm -rf /tmp/hekate_update rm -rf /mnt/sdcard/bootloader_backup5.3 自动化备份设置配置定期自动备份以降低未来升级风险# 创建备份脚本 cat /mnt/sdcard/bootloader/backup.sh EOF #!/bin/bash TIMESTAMP\$(date %Y%m%d_%H%M%S) mkdir /mnt/sdcard/backups/\$TIMESTAMP cp -r /mnt/sdcard/bootloader /mnt/sdcard/backups/\$TIMESTAMP/ EOF # 添加执行权限 chmod x /mnt/sdcard/bootloader/backup.sh六、常见问题排查6.1 启动失败问题症状设备黑屏或停留在Hekate logo界面解决步骤检查SD卡接触是否良好尝试重新插拔验证hekate_ipl.ini文件语法正确性从备份恢复sys文件夹执行以下命令cp -r /mnt/sdcard/backups/latest/bootloader/sys /mnt/sdcard/bootloader/6.2 配置丢失问题预防措施升级前执行完整备份并确认备份文件完整性恢复方法cp /mnt/sdcard/backups/latest/bootloader/hekate_ipl.ini /mnt/sdcard/bootloader/6.3 功能异常问题排查流程查看系统日志获取错误信息cat /mnt/sdcard/bootloader/hekate.log检查相关模块是否正确加载尝试使用默认配置文件测试七、升级维护建议为确保系统长期稳定运行建议采取以下维护措施定期更新检查每月检查官方仓库获取安全更新备份策略建立升级前必备份的操作习惯配置管理使用版本控制工具管理配置文件变更环境记录记录每次升级的版本信息和配置变更通过遵循本指南的安全更新流程用户可以有效降低升级风险确保Hekate引导程序始终运行在最佳状态。在整个升级过程中保持谨慎操作和完整备份是保障系统安全的关键原则。【免费下载链接】hekatehekate - A GUI based Nintendo Switch Bootloader项目地址: https://gitcode.com/gh_mirrors/he/hekate创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考